4.72 ALL_SEQUENCES

ALL_SEQUENCESは、現行のユーザーがアクセスできる順序をすべて示します。

関連ビュー

  • DBA_SEQUENCESは、データベース内の順序をすべて示します。

  • USER_SEQUENCESは、現行のユーザーが所有する順序をすべて示します。このビューは、SEQUENCE_OWNER列を表示しません。

データ型 NULL 説明

SEQUENCE_OWNER

VARCHAR2(128)

NOT NULL

順序の所有者

SEQUENCE_NAME

VARCHAR2(128)

NOT NULL

順序名

MIN_VALUE

NUMBER

順序の最小値

MAX_VALUE

NUMBER

順序の最大値

INCREMENT_BY

NUMBER

NOT NULL

順序が増やされるときの増分値

CYCLE_FLAG

VARCHAR2(1)

限度に達したときに、順序の繰返しを実行するかどうか(Y | N)

ORDER_FLAG

VARCHAR2(1)

順序番号が順番に生成されるかどうか(Y | N)

CACHE_SIZE

NUMBER

NOT NULL

キャッシュする順序番号の数

LAST_NUMBER

NUMBER

NOT NULL

ディスクに書き込む最後の順序番号。順序でキャッシュを使用する場合、ディスクに書き込まれる番号は順序キャッシュ内の最後の番号です。ほとんどの場合、この番号は最後に使用された順序番号より大きくなります。

セッション順序では、この列の値は無視する必要がある。

SCALE_FLAG

VARCHAR2(1)

スケーラブルな順序かどうか(Y | N)

EXTEND_FLAG

VARCHAR2(1)

このスケーラブルな順序の生成された値をMAX_VALUEまたはMIN_VALUEを超えて拡張するかどうか(Y | N)

SHARDED_FLAG

脚注1

VARCHAR2(1)

シャードされた順序かどうか(Y | N)

SESSION_FLAG

VARCHAR2(1)

順序値がセッション・プライベートであるかどうか(Y | N)

KEEP_VALUE

VARCHAR2(1)

エラー後の再実行時、順序値が保持されるかどうか(Y | N)

脚注1 この列は、Oracle Databaseリリース19c, バージョン19.1以降で使用可能です。

関連項目: